			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I would take an action figure or doll and a box. (a shoe box is fine) Then  I would have them decorate and furnish their &#8216;house&#8217; or headquarters out of what they can find at the campsite. They did a lot of weaving leaves and vines for ladders and blankets It is an activity that can last the entire trip and fill up &#8216;I&#8217;m bored&#8217; time. We also would make &#8216;stone soup&#8217; from the book or any recipe from their favorite book. The Little House series has it&#8217;s own cook book.</p>
